Last summer's trip to Gilmore Museum and seeing its beautiful '36 Cadillac Sixteen Aero Coupe inspired this work-up. Lots of precedence for the design by 1938 including the Cadillac, Packard's own '34 Aero Coupe, '34 Lincoln LeBaron sport sedan, '36 Zephyr and '36 Cord. Windshield is raked like Brunn and roof is lowered an inch for sportiness.
